What fails here
Common leak problems in Wembley
01
Leaks in High-Rise Service Ducts
New-build towers route plumbing through vertical service ducts shared by multiple flats. A leak from one flat's supply or waste pipe can travel down these ducts, affecting units several floors below. Pinpointing the source flat requires systematic pressure testing and access panel inspection.
02
Event-Day Pressure Surges
On major event days at the stadium, area-wide water usage spikes dramatically. This creates sudden pressure changes that can blow old weak joints in neighbouring Victorian conversions. We often see leaks manifest in these older properties just after large events finish.
03
Balcony Drainage Leaks
Many new apartments have balcony drains that tie into the main waste system. Blockages or failed seals at these connections cause water to leak back into the building's structure, often appearing as damp on ceilings below balcony level.
04
Shared HMO Heating Leaks
Converted houses operating as HMOs frequently have single central heating systems serving multiple units. Leaks from ageing radiators or pipework in one tenant's room can migrate through floorboards into common areas or other bedrooms below.
Three methods, one marked point
Acoustic survey
Ground microphones and correlators follow the sound of escaping water through floors and ground.
Thermal imaging
Infrared cameras reveal wet patches and buried heating runs through the floor surface.
Tracer gas
A safe hydrogen mix escapes through the exact failure point and rises to our surface detector.

What does leak detection cost in Wembley?
A fixed fee agreed at booking — typically £250–£450 for a domestic detection visit — covered by no find, no fee. That includes pressure testing per circuit, thermal imaging, acoustic survey and moisture mapping. Repairs are quoted separately before any work starts.
